It was found that the weak chemiluminescence produced from the reaction of polyhydroxy phenols with luminol in alkaline solution could be strongly enhanced by ferricyanide and ferrocyanide. Based on this found, a new flow injection chemiluminescence method is proposed for the determination of four polyhydroxy phenols: Pyrogallol, phlorglucinol, quinol and resorcinol. The detection limits of the method are 0.03 μg ml-1 pyrogallol, 0.03 μg ml-1 phlorglucinol, 0.04 μg ml-1 quinol, and 0.02 μg ml-1 resorcinol. The possible mechanism of CL reactions is also discussed briefly.
